Sr. Procurement Consultant
We are looking for an experienced Sr. Procurement Consultant to join our team in Overland Park, Kansas. This long-term contract position offers an exciting opportunity to lead procurement strategies and contract execution for critical categories supporting data center solutions. The role requires onsite presence four days per week and one remote day, allowing you to collaborate closely with cross-functional teams in a dynamic, fast-paced environment.<br><br>Responsibilities:<br>• Develop and execute procurement strategies aligned with organizational objectives and solution delivery needs.<br>• Conduct detailed market and pricing analyses to support informed sourcing decisions.<br>• Lead competitive bidding processes for diverse categories, including construction, technology, and services.<br>• Draft comprehensive scopes of work that address technical, operational, and compliance requirements.<br>• Negotiate contracts to ensure scalability, cost efficiency, and speed-to-market.<br>• Collaborate with legal, finance, engineering, and operations teams to optimize procurement outcomes.<br>• Provide strategic insights to enhance procurement processes and support organizational growth.<br>• Manage vendor relationships and ensure alignment with project timelines and goals.<br>• Monitor industry trends to identify opportunities for innovation and cost savings.
• Extensive experience in government, corporate, or indirect procurement.<br>• Proven expertise in contract negotiations and competitive bidding.<br>• Strong analytical skills for conducting market and pricing analysis.<br>• Ability to draft and manage scopes of work for complex categories.<br>• Familiarity with purchasing processes and procurement systems.<br>•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with experience working cross-functionally.<br>• Capacity to thrive in a fast-paced, high-growth environment.<br>• Willingness to work onsite four days per week, with one remote day.
